Edgars takes its goods online

By Staff Reporter, ITWeb
Johannesburg, 21 Sep 2000

Edcon has launched its online shopping service, Edgars.co.za. The site went live at the beginning of the week. The initiative represents the first stage in the delivery of the group`s wide-reaching e-business strategy.

Commenting on the new site, Steve Ross, chief executive of Edcon, says: "The value for shareholders lies in our ability to lead the pack in a fast changing environment where e-business is increasingly becoming the norm.

"Edgars.co.za is an important component of Edcon`s e-business strategy which encompasses suppliers, customers, the internal business environment as well as industry-wide developments like retail hubs and exchanges. In terms of profitability, we do not see the business to customer component in isolation as its success will add value throughout the supply chain.

"By launching www.edgars.co.za, our intention is to create a seamless online/offline service offering for our customers."

"Thanks to its established infrastructure and customer base, Edcon is well-placed to use the `clicks and mortar` model to leverage competitive advantage in the South African market," says Brad Coward, the group strategic project executive who led the project team.

The new site, which has been developed with Andersen Consulting and The Jupiter Drawing Room, offers a quick, "three-click" navigation standard. Local technological limitations such as bandwidth and browser capability have been addressed and the technology has been extensively tested.

Payment for goods can be made using any major credit card or with the range of Edcon store cards. Encryption technology has been used to ensure maximum security for personal financial information and this is supported by an authentication procedure.

Customers have three delivery options to anywhere in SA: two days to door, five days to door, or seven-day self pick-up at an Edgars store of choice. Weekend delivery is also an option.

Edgars currently has a 5 million strong customer base and 3.5 million account holders. Those customers who choose to shop with www.edgars.co.za can also take advantage of patented service offerings such as the "The Decision Maker" and "The Edgars Assistant", as well as a free gift-wrapping and messaging service for all purchases.

"Edcon sees this B2C [business-to-customer] initiative as the foundation for a number of future opportunities, including taking other stores within the group online and developing international payment and fulfilment capabilities," notes Coward.
